On a dedicated 1.17.0.03 bedrock server, Raw iron doesn't smelt in a furnace, as in previous snapshots.
Steps to reproduce: connect to a 1.17.0.03 dedicated bedrock server with bedrock minecraft. Put raw iron in a furnace and coal in the bottom, or other fuel items like a crafting table. It doesn't smelt.
If it helps, porkchops were cookable on this setup. |
